Zig Zag Spiny Barred Eel
Mastacembelus pancalus
Water Temp: 72-82° F
KH 10-16
pH 6.8-7.2
Max. Size: 2′ 6″
Native to: SE Asia
Family: Mastacembelidae
The Zig Zag Eel is a nocturnal predator. They are not true eels as they are an elongated tropical freshwater fish that has numerous spines preceding the dorsal fin. The Zig Zag Eel will prefer about 1 teaspoon of salt for every 1 gallon of freshwater. This fish should be kept with other large fish that the eel will not consider as dinner. This Eel should be fed freeze-dried bloodworms, shrimp, and pellet foods. Shipped about 3 – 5″
